male child of your child
The son of your son or the son of your daughter.
Vartosenos šablonas:
[someone]'s grandson
Dažna klaida:
Learners sometimes confuse 'grandson' with 'nephew'. A 'grandson' is the son of your son or daughter. A 'nephew' is the son of your brother or sister. Learners may also say 'boy grandchild' instead of the natural term 'grandson'.
